Rabbinical College Beth Shraga vs. SUNY College at Old Westbury
Both Rabbinical College Beth Shraga and SUNY College at Old Westbury are 4 years schools located in New York. The following statements compare Rabbinical College Beth Shraga and SUNY College at Old Westbury with important academic statistics including tuition, test scores, and admission rate.
- SUNY College at Old Westbury's tuition ($18,289) is more expensive than Rabbinical College Beth Shraga ($16,150).
- Rabbinical College Beth Shraga's acceptance rate (87.50%) is lower than SUNY College at Old Westbury (92.10%).
- Rabbinical College Beth Shraga has higher yield (100.00%) than SUNY College at Old Westbury (17.34%).
- Both schools have same SAT scores of 1,110.
- Rabbinical College Beth Shraga's students to faculty ratio (10 to 1) is lower than SUNY College at Old Westbury (16 to 1).
- SUNY College at Old Westbury (4,270 students) is larger than Rabbinical College Beth Shraga (38 students) with more enrolled students.
- SUNY College at Old Westbury ($9,966) has higher amount of financial aid than Rabbinical College Beth Shraga ($9,541).
- Rabbinical College Beth Shraga's graduation rate (56%) is higher than SUNY College at Old Westbury (48%).
